当前位置:实例文章 » 其他实例» [文章]BlockUI InterpartSelection部件间选择选项

BlockUI InterpartSelection部件间选择选项

发布人:shili8 发布时间:2025-01-13 11:18 阅读次数:0

**BlockUI Interpart Selection 部件间选择选项**

在某些情况下,我们需要让用户从多个选项中进行选择,而这些选项可能是来自不同的部门或来源。这种场景下,使用 BlockUI 的 InterpartSelection 部件可以帮助我们实现这一功能。

###什么是BlockUI?

BlockUI 是一个用于阻止页面滚动和点击的 JavaScript 库,它可以在页面加载时显示一个遮罩层,从而防止用户干扰正在进行的操作。它还提供了许多有用的方法来控制遮罩层的行为。

###什么是InterpartSelection?

InterpartSelection 是 BlockUI 中的一个组件,用于实现部门间选择选项。它允许用户从多个选项中进行选择,而这些选项可能来自不同的部门或来源。

### 如何使用BlockUI InterpartSelection部件要使用 BlockUI 的 InterpartSelection 部件,我们需要在页面中引入 BlockUI 库,然后创建一个 InterpartSelection 实例。下面是示例代码:

html<!-- 引入BlockUI库 -->
<script src=" />
<!-- 创建InterpartSelection实例 -->
<div id="interpart-selection" class="blockui-interpart-selection">
 <h2>选择部门</h2>
 <ul>
 <li><a href="#" data-department="销售部">销售部</a></li>
 <li><a href="#" data-department="研发部">研发部</a></li>
 <li><a href="#" data-department="市场部">市场部</a></li>
 </ul>
</div>

<!-- 初始化InterpartSelection实例 -->
<script>
 var interpartSelection = new BlockUI.InterpartSelection({
 selector: '#interpart-selection',
 onSelected: function(department) {
 console.log('选中部门:', department);
 }
 });
</script>

在上面的示例代码中,我们首先引入了 BlockUI 库,然后创建了一个 InterpartSelection 实例。我们传递了一个配置对象给实例,指定了选择器和回调函数。

### 配置选项InterpartSelection 部件提供了多个配置选项,可以根据具体需求进行调整。下面是这些配置选项的说明:

* `selector`: 指定选择器元素的 ID 或类名。
* `onSelected`: 回调函数,会在用户选择部门时被触发。回调函数接收一个参数,表示当前选中的部门。

###事件处理InterpartSelection 部件提供了多个事件处理方法,可以根据具体需求进行调整。下面是这些事件处理方法的说明:

* `onSelect`: 当用户选择部门时会触发此事件。
* `onDeselect`: 当用户取消选择部门时会触发此事件。

### 示例代码以下是示例代码:
html<!-- 引入BlockUI库 -->
<script src=" />
<!-- 创建InterpartSelection实例 -->
<div id="interpart-selection" class="blockui-interpart-selection">
 <h2>选择部门</h2>
 <ul>
 <li><a href="#" data-department="销售部">销售部</a></li>
 <li><a href="#" data-department="研发部">研发部</a></li>
 <li><a href="#" data-department="市场部">市场部</a></li>
 </ul>
</div>

<!-- 初始化InterpartSelection实例 -->
<script>
 var interpartSelection = new BlockUI.InterpartSelection({
 selector: '#interpart-selection',
 onSelected: function(department) {
 console.log('选中部门:', department);
 },
 onSelect: function(department) {
 console.log('选择部门:', department);
 },
 onDeselect: function(department) {
 console.log('取消选择部门:', department);
 }
 });
</script>

在上面的示例代码中,我们首先引入了 BlockUI 库,然后创建了一个 InterpartSelection 实例。我们传递了一个配置对象给实例,指定了选择器、回调函数和事件处理方法。

### 总结BlockUI 的 InterpartSelection 部件可以帮助我们实现部门间选择选项。在本文中,我们介绍了 BlockUI 库的基本概念、InterpartSelection 部件的使用方法、配置选项和事件处理方法。通过阅读本文,读者可以了解如何使用 BlockUI 的 InterpartSelection 部件来实现部门间选择选项。

相关标签:int
其他信息

其他资源

Top